Abstract
a finalidade da presente invenção é proporcionar uma levedura tendo uma capacidade melhorada para produzir etanol a partir de xilose. a presente invenção proporciona uma levedura transformada produzida por introdução funcional de genes de assimilação de xilose e genes de enzima de uma via de pentose fosfato e de uma via de produção de etanol em uma levedura hospedeira.The purpose of the present invention is to provide a yeast having an improved ability to produce ethanol from xylose. The present invention provides a transformed yeast produced by functional introduction of xylose assimilation genes and enzyme genes from a pentose phosphate pathway and an ethanol production pathway into a host yeast.
